About Mistral’s Products

Our suite of AI-powered tools is transforming workflows:
Le Chat: The conversational interface for seamless human-AI interaction.
AI Studio: The platform for building and deploying AI agents.
Mistral Vibe: The coding companion that turns ideas into code.

We’re here to decode how users engage with these tools, identify friction points, and uncover opportunities to make them indispensable—especially in enterprise contexts.

What You’ll Do

Define the research function: Establish processes for user interviews, persona development, and usability testing at speed.
Uncover insights: Conduct interviews and analyze data to reveal *why* users behave the way they do.
Shape strategy: Translate research into clear, actionable recommendations for product and design teams.
Collaborate cross-functionally: Work closely with Product, Engineering, Science, and Solutions to align research with business goals.
Test and iterate: Evaluate new designs and features through rapid user testing, ensuring they meet real needs.
